' ';'■'' The Wairarapa Caledonian Society is leaving no 6tono untnrucd in tho preparation of tho running track for their gathering on New Year's' Day, tho Mnsterton ' Gprpugh Council having acceded to the request of tho Agricultural Assopiation for the-use of/the Council's road roller-and water cart. With their aid a track second to none in tho district; is now being laid down, ••
